The size of Ridleyton is approximately 0.4 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 5.2% of total area. The population of Ridleyton in 2016 was 1128 people. By 2021 the population was 1180 showing a population growth of 4.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ridleyton is 20-29 years. Households in Ridleyton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ridleyton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 47.00% of the homes in Ridleyton were owner-occupied compared with 46.20% in 2016.
